I'm installing two floor drains in my 32 x 44' thickened edge slab. Slab is still not poured and I still need to add 5-6" of stone inside my forms before I'm ready to pour. Should I wait until stone is in place before I install drains or try and add them first?
I know I'd have to dig part of a trench in the stone but stone trench would also help hold everything in place.
I'd get enough stone in that they're full supported, and everything around and below them is compacted already. Really, either way will work, a little trenching in compacted gravel never killed anybody.......
